The VW3E1146R160 is officially obsolete per Schneider Electric's lifecycle status. This is the hybrid cable that connects a Lexium 62 ILM servo drive to the distribution box D2 in a PacDrive 3 system — 16 m shielded motor cable with an RJ45 D2 elbowed connector at one end. For a line running PacDrive 3 motion, this cable is the specific link between the drive module and the distribution box; the 16 m length suits longer panel-to-machine runs where the distribution box sits remote from the drive cluster.
The 16 m (52.5 ft) cable length is the full run from the Lexium 62 ILM connection module to the D2 distribution box — not a cut-to-length field cable. The RJ45 D2 connector is elbowed (right-angle exit), which matters when routing in a tight cabinet or along a cable tray where a straight plug would strain the termination. The shielded construction is standard for motor power cables carrying PWM drive signals; the shield keeps radiated emissions within the limits the PacDrive 3 system was certified to. The cable is part of the PacDrive 3 range, which means it mates with the specific D2 distribution box connector and the ILM drive's hybrid port. It is not a generic RJ45 patch cable — the pinout and conductor gauge are sized for the motor power and feedback signals combined in one jacket.
